Chapter 108 The Wicked Stepmother and the Poor Child 1
In the tenth year of Jinghe, at the Gu residence.
In late spring, the front and back courtyards of the Gu residence were clearly separated.
The front yard was filled with joy and excitement, decorated with lanterns and colorful streamers. Servants carried brocade boxes and trunks, coming and going in a constant stream, their faces beaming with happiness.
Some of the pillars were even wrapped with red silk that fluttered in the breeze, which looked like good things were about to happen. However, the main courtyard where the mistress was located was separated from the main courtyard by this festive atmosphere.
The main courtyard was deathly still, and there was a medicinal smell in the air.
The maids and servants entering and leaving the main courtyard all had furrowed brows and walked very quietly, afraid of disturbing the lady inside who was nearing the end of her life.
The room was filled with the lingering smell of medicine.
"Dan Gui, what's going on outside?"
Why is it so noisy?
The woman on the sickbed weakly stretched out her hand, her voice barely audible. Her hand was so thin that only a thin layer of skin covered her bones, a sight that was heartbreaking.
Dan Gui, the personal maid, quickly turned away to wipe her red and swollen eyes before carrying a warm bowl of medicine forward in a soft voice.
"It's alright, Madam, you must have misheard. It's a happy occasion at the neighbor's house next door."
"Madam, please take your medicine first. You'll feel better afterward."
The pale-faced woman wearily closed her eyes, too exhausted to even shake her head.
"There's no need to waste anything anymore. I know my own body. After I'm gone, you must protect the young lady and the young master."
I'll leave all my things to my two children.
As soon as she finished speaking, her hand loosened, her head tilted limply to the other side, and she fainted again.
Dan Gui's tears welled up instantly, and she bit her lip gently, trying not to let out a sound.
The lady has been bedridden for over a year, and her condition is deteriorating day by day. But the master, let alone coming to see her in person, doesn't even bother to ask her a single question.
This main courtyard is now just waiting for the lady to breathe her last.
They were newlyweds, deeply in love, but now they are disgusted with each other, all within a short span of five years.
In stark contrast to the main courtyard, the area in front of the Gu residence was bustling with activity.
The head of the family, Gu Hongjian, was waiting at the door. He was dressed in an indigo blue robe, with a tall and handsome figure. Five years of experience in officialdom had made him look even more composed. At this moment, he was constantly looking at the other side.
A short while later, an elegantly decorated carriage bearing the family crest stopped in front of the Gu residence.
After the carriage curtain was lifted, a woman dressed in a purple dress slowly descended, supported by her maid. She exuded a scholarly air and looked gentle and charming. This was Zhou Jingxuan, the niece of the Vice Minister of the Ministry of Personnel.
"Jingxuan, you've finally arrived."
"Recently, there have been numerous trivial matters at home, and I am simply overwhelmed."
Gu Hongjian stepped forward and affectionately took her hand, saying...
Zhou Jingxuan blushed, gently withdrew her hand, glanced at the servants around her, and whispered.
"Don't worry, Mr. Gu. Now that we're here, we'll naturally help you with your worries and troubles."
The two of them were so openly affectionate at the front door that the neighbors all saw it and couldn't help but gossip.
"Look at this, the old man hasn't even breathed his last yet, and they're already eager to welcome the newcomer? This is simply outrageous!"
"Who says otherwise? Even if someone passes away, a decent family would stay for a year or two, right?"
Gu Hongjian was once famous in the capital for his unwavering loyalty to his wife, but now, his behavior is...tsk tsk.
"Madam Gu is such a kind person, she must have been blind to marry such a heartless bastard!"
“Shh——
Keep your voice down! This Miss Zhou is no ordinary person; I've heard she's one of Lord Gu's stepping stones to success.
"Oh? No wonder he was the top scholar for five years but was still only a seventh-rank editor. Recently, I heard he was going to be promoted. It turns out he was going to use a woman's influence."
"What a heartless man! Another Chen Shimei!"
Amidst the hushed whispers, Gu Hongjian paid no heed and loudly gave the order.
"Guards, welcome Miss Zhou into the manor!"
Zhou Jingxuan was placed in the Shuyu Pavilion in the mansion. Although it was not the main courtyard, it was decorated with great care and was even better than the main courtyard.
"Jingxuan, I'm sorry you have to suffer for now. Once she's gone, I will definitely bring you into the main courtyard in a grand and glorious manner."
Zhou Jingxuan smiled gently and said understandingly.
"What are you saying, Gu Lang? My sister is still alive, how can I overstep my bounds?"
I already feel uneasy about being asked to enter the mansion ahead of schedule.
Has my sister's illness improved recently?
Gu Hongjian looked grief-stricken and shook his head with a sigh.
"The imperial physician said that it would only take three to five days at most."
Jingxuan, just be patient a little longer. Soon, we'll be able to be together openly and legitimately.
No one can say that a widower should remarry, especially since the two have been together for a long time and all that's missing now is a formal title.
"From today onwards, I have already instructed everyone in the household that you will be in full charge of managing the household affairs. If any servants are disobedient, you may deal with them as you see fit."
In my heart, you are already my wife.
Upon hearing this, Zhou Jingxuan smiled shyly and nestled into his arms.
"Don't worry, Mr. Gu, I will definitely not let you worry about matters in the inner quarters."
The two embraced, their figures overlapping, looking like a perfect couple.
...
Inside the system space, Shen Ci, whose world had not yet been loaded, watched this scene through the light screen, feeling heartbroken and pained.
"I've really opened my eyes. The original wife isn't even completely dead yet, and he's already in a hurry to bring the mistress into the house. He's not even bothering to pretend anymore."
Are these two counting down the days until the wife dies?
She complained to the system.
"Host, please be patient. We are transmitting background information for this world to you," the system's cold electronic voice announced.
A flood of information rushed into Shen Ci's mind.
This is a typical story of how unfaithful men are often scholars, and how a top scholar ultimately becomes an unfaithful man.
Shen Ci, the daughter of a merchant, disregarded her family's objections and married Gu Hongjian, a poor scholar. She used all of her dowry to help him study and eventually made him the top scholar in the imperial examination.
Gu Hongjian initially earned a reputation for not forgetting his wife, bringing her to the capital. Unfortunately, this happy period lasted only five years, as Shen Ci fell ill from overwork and never recovered.
This illness is also quite strange.
Gu Hongjian had long grown tired of his first wife, who could not help his career, and started an affair with Zhou Jingxuan, the niece of the Vice Minister of the Ministry of Personnel.
He was with Shen Ci when he needed money; now he wants power.
Once Shen Ci dies, he will be able to remarry a woman from a wealthy family and embark on a path to success.
After Shen Ci's death, her five-year-old twin sons, Gu Mingzhang and Gu Mingzhu, will have to live a difficult life under their stepmother's care.
Zhou Jingxuan appears virtuous and gentle, but in reality, she is ruthless and cruel, wantonly abusing and spoiling her two children.
In the end, his son Gu Mingzhang was beaten to death in a fight, and Gu Hongjian took the opportunity to kill his own son for the greater good. His daughter Gu Mingzhu was tricked into losing her virginity, hastily married to a stable boy, suffered endless humiliation, and died young.
Neither of their two children lived past the age of 20.
Shen Ci was furious.
"These two children are clearly the most pitiful people, the biggest victims, how can they be the villains?"
"Host, don't be angry. This is the judgment of the Heavenly Dao of this small world."
In Gu Hongjian and Zhou Jingxuan's eyes, the children born to their first wives were the most annoying villains in their happy life and should be eliminated.
Our purpose in being is to correct such misalignments caused by the injustice of fate.
Break the shackles of fate imposed on those with great fortune. The villains chosen by the system often possess immense luck, yet they all meet tragic ends. The host's mission is to reverse their fate.
